Region: Pessac, France

Vintage: 2015

Composition: 49.4% Merlot, 38.7% Cabernet Sauvignon, and 11.9% Cabernet Franc

History: Approximately 2000 years ago, the virtues of these tiny quartz pebbles called gravels were discovered. The earliest written mention that we have discovered yet, specifically speaking of a wine produced from these very soils, dates back to 1521. When he purchased Château Haut-Brion in 1935, Clarence Dillon restored it to its former glory and to the elite circle of the most legendary wines in the world. This extraordinary, bold, courageous vision is now continued by the fourth generation of the family, represented by Prince Robert of Luxembourg, Chairman and CEO since 2008. Located in the town of Pessac, just a few kilometres from Bordeaux, Château Haut-Brion – the first of the three estates acquired by the Dillon family – is the oldest winegrowing property in the region.

Tasting Notes:

Dark, intense red colour. The initial impression on the nose is deep, spicy and incredibly complex, underscored by ripe black fruit aromas. Starts out soft and well-structured on the palate, becoming full-bodied with impressive volume and smooth tannin. The finish is incredibly long, enhanced by rich flavours that are neither heavy nor harsh.
